11 references to DataContent
Microsoft.Extensions.AI.Abstractions.Tests (4)
ChatCompletion\ChatMessageTests.cs (1)
259
new
DataContent
(new Uri("data:text/plain;base64,aGVsbG8="), "mime-type/2")
Contents\DataContentTests.cs (3)
83
content = new
DataContent
(new Uri("data:text/plain,"), mediaType);
106
content = new
DataContent
(new Uri("data:image/png;base64,aGVsbG8="));
128
Validate(new
DataContent
(new Uri(uri)), expectedData);
Microsoft.Extensions.AI.Evaluation.Integration.Tests (2)
SafetyEvaluatorTests.cs (2)
379
new
DataContent
(ImageDataUri.GetImageDataUri())],
413
new
DataContent
(ImageDataUri.GetImageDataUri())],
Microsoft.Extensions.AI.Integration.Tests (2)
ChatClientIntegrationTests.cs (2)
196
new
DataContent
(ImageDataUri.GetImageDataUri(), "image/png"),
214
new
DataContent
(ImageDataUri.GetPdfDataUri(), "application/pdf") { Name = "sample.pdf" },
Microsoft.Extensions.AI.OpenAI.Tests (3)
OpenAIChatClientTests.cs (1)
1588
new
DataContent
(ImageDataUri.GetImageDataUri(), "image/png")
OpenAIResponseClientIntegrationTests.cs (2)
489
Tools = [AIFunctionFactory.Create(() => new
DataContent
(ImageDataUri.GetImageDataUri(), "image/png"), "GetDotnetLogo", "Returns the .NET logo image")]
514
Tools = [AIFunctionFactory.Create(() => new
DataContent
(ImageDataUri.GetPdfDataUri(), "application/pdf") { Name = "document.pdf" }, "GetDocument", "Returns a PDF document")]